Show modern player card
Name Team Age
Willie Carroll Retired (2025, Age 36) Died (2061, Age 72)
Drafted Position Bats/Throws
Round 1, Pick 14
(2013)
SP R/R
League Option Years   Majors Service Time
Ivan Rodriguez League 0 11 years (63 games)
Total Rating   Arm Range
B-
Contact vs R Contact vs L Speed
D- C-
Power vs R Power vs L Bunting
D-
Endurance Velocity Control
B- B- B+
Leadership   Mentor Value  
B-
Health   Injured Days   Birthday
D- 0 5/9/1989
WS Rings WS Appearances LCS Appearances
0 0 0
Alt Pos (---) Alt Pos (---) Alt Pos (---)
(0.0 %) (0.0 %) (0.0 %)

Stats  |   Splits  |   Playoffs  |   Energy  |   Improvements  |   Past Skills  |   Awards   |  Batting   |  Fielding   |  Game Log
Year Type   Chances    Endurance   Velocity   Control   Total 
2013 Minors 11.00 0 / 2 0 / 6 0 / 3 0 / 11
2013 Majors 41.53 2 / 10 3 / 19 2 / 12 7 / 41
2014 Majors 51.77 1 / 13 2 / 20 5 / 18 8 / 51
2015 Minors 3.00 0 / 0 0 / 2 0 / 1 0 / 3
2015 Majors 47.18 2 / 7 3 / 21 5 / 19 10 / 47
2016 Majors 52.67 2 / 12 0 / 14 1 / 26 3 / 52
2017 Majors 41.81 0 / 4 1 / 20 1 / 17 2 / 41
2018 Majors 51.94 1 / 14 0 / 14 0 / 23 1 / 51
2019 Majors 53.36 1 / 14 1 / 16 2 / 23 4 / 53
2020 Majors 45.16 0 / 9 1 / 17 1 / 19 2 / 45
2021 Majors 49.36 0 / 10 0 / 21 1 / 18 1 / 49
2022 Majors 45.35 0 / 12 0 / 16 1 / 17 1 / 45
2023 Majors 46.05 0 / 14 -2 / 17 -1 / 15 -3 / 46
2024 Minors 13.00 0 / 0 0 / 9 0 / 4 0 / 13
2024 Majors 22.42 -3 / 0 -1 / 13 -6 / 9 -10 / 22
2025 Minors 70.00 0 / 5 0 / 40 0 / 25 0 / 70
2025 Majors 0.83 -1 / 0 -3 / 0 -7 / 0 -11 / 0
Total 5 / 126 5 / 265 5 / 249 15 / 640
Career Transactions
DateTransaction
2025-11-01Willie Carroll has retired from the Free Agency Pool
2025-10-03The Oakland Bays have sent George Spradlin to the minors. The Oakland Bays have designated Willie Carroll for assignment. The Oakland Bays have sent Joe McElyea to the minors.
2025-09-29The Oakland Bays have promoted George Spradlin to the major league team. The Oakland Bays have promoted Willie Carroll to the major league team. The Oakland Bays have promoted Joe McElyea to the major league team.
2024-08-16The Oakland Bays have designated Willie Carroll for assignment.
2018-04-01The Oakland Bays have promoted Willie Carroll to the major league team.
2018-03-25The Oakland Bays have promoted Roy Schultz to the major league team. The Oakland Bays have promoted Edgar Blair to the major league team. The Oakland Bays have promoted Marcelino Valle to the major league team. The Oakland Bays have promoted Brady Alcantara to the major league team. The Oakland Bays have designated Lou Pagliaroni for assignment. The Oakland Bays have sent Willie Carroll to the minors.
2017-05-19Willie Carroll of the Oakland Bays is injured and is expected to be out 43 days.
2015-04-29The Oakland Bays have promoted Willie Carroll to the major league team. The Oakland Bays have designated Tom Toporcer for assignment.
2015-04-10The Oakland Bays have demoted Willie Carroll to the minor leagues.
2013-05-20A trade has been completed between the Tampa Bay Panic and the Oakland Bays. The Oakland Bays receive Willie Carroll, Draft Pick - 2016 Round 2 (TB) from the Tampa Bay Panic in exchange for Heinie Hague.